Founded in 1937, the Arkansas Museum of Fine Arts is the largest cultural institution of its kind in the region, offering a unique blend of visual and performing arts experiences.

This richly illustrated book celebrates the opening of the museum’s new landmark building, introducing the museum’s collection for the first time within its stunning architecture, designed by Studio Gang, and landscape, designed by SCAPE. AMFA’s international collection spans seven centuries, with strengths in works on paper and contemporary craft, and includes notable holdings by artists from Arkansas, the Mid-South region, and across the United States and Europe.

Located in Little Rock’s oldest urban green space, MacArthur Park, AMFA’s landmark building and grounds are realized in collaboration with Polk Stanley Wilcox Architects.

This celebratory volume will be essential to all visitors, and anyone interested in the art and architecture of the American South.
